Zusammenfassung:•Schizophrenia and bipolar disorder were classified by using fNIRS & ML approaches.•Dynamic functional connectivity based features were used.•SCZ vs HC, BP vs HC and SCZ vs BP accuracies were found as 82.5%, 79% and 75.5%.•Dynamic functional connections might be biomarkers for psychiatric disorders.
